NYS speeding tickets


What is the name of your state? New York State

I've gotten a speeding ticket in the New York State around the Buffalo area for travelling at 78mph in a 55mph zone. The ticket does not show how much fine and demerit points they will charge me. Instead, I would need to fill out a form indicating whether or not I plea guilty. If I do then they will send me the charges and I'll pay it. If I plea not guilty, then I'll have to go to court.

I would like to know how much would the fine be if I plea guilty?
And if I plea not guilty, go to court and got denied, would there be any additional charges?

That's how it works in NY. Normally your best option is to plead not guilty and then try to talk to the ADA and get a reduction prior to your court date. That could be awhile since some NY courts are up to a year behind.

Your best bet is to show up for the appearance date. You will likely be offered the chance to plead guilty to lesser speed, which means a lower fine and less points.
